YouTube TV has rolled out a new integration that lets subscribers link their accounts inside the Sports section of the YouTube TV mobile app and then see Unlimited listed in the app as part of their subscription. The path runs through the Connect option in Settings, turning a sports-viewing shortcut into a direct bridge between the two apps.

The feature is drawing attention now because it arrives as the new NFL season gets closer, when viewers are more likely to be tracking games and fantasy scores at the same time. For subscribers who move between live sports and Fantasy, the appeal is simple: one connection can make the handoff from YouTube TV to easier while keeping NFL fantasy data in view.

Inside the YouTube TV mobile app, the process starts in Sports settings. Users can toggle on Connect, or choose Connect Fantasy Football, which brings up a prompt and sends them to an activation page. From there, the user is asked to agree to the terms, sign in with email and password, and decide whether to share Fantasy data with YouTube TV before the link is confirmed and the app returns with a confirmation message.

That is where the fine print matters. The connection surfaces Unlimited in the app after the accounts are linked, but viewers still may need to open the app and have active credentials and any required subscriptions in place before they can stream live events. In other words, the link opens the door, but it does not appear to replace every other step needed to start watching.

For YouTube TV, the update fits a broader push to make sports viewing feel more complete inside its own app, especially for fans who want live games and fantasy tracking in the same place. The practical next step is straightforward: link the accounts in Sports settings, then open the app and check whether Unlimited appears on mobile as part of the plan. What remains unclear is how broad the access is beyond that setup, since the connection itself does not spell out every subscription requirement on its own.
